Melissa Guller is the Head of Special Projects at Teachable, a platform for entrepreneurs to build successful online teaching careers. At different points in her career, she has managed budgets over $1M, project teams of 30+ people, change management programs across 4 offices, and 300 projects (events) in a single quarter.
